How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ashton Woodenbridge?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Ashton Woodenbridge Studio Apartments | $1,051 | $895 | $1,250 |
Ashton Woodenbridge 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,405 | $895 | $1,845 |
Ashton Woodenbridge 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,672 | $1,263 | $2,134 |
Ashton Woodenbridge 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,796 | $1,500 | $1,899 |
Ashton Woodenbridge 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,627 | $2,523 | $2,732 |
